About The Position

The Supply Chain Planner is responsible for supporting production planning, demand alignment, and supply coordination across internal operations and external supply chain partners. This role ensures material availability, optimizes production schedules, and aligns customer demand with manufacturing and logistics capacity. The planner plays a critical role in balancing production requirements, overseas shipping plans, and inventory levels while enhancing overall supply chain efficiency and supporting high levels of customer satisfaction.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and maintain detailed production schedules that meet customer demand while maximizing manufacturing efficiency.
  • Monitor daily production performance and adjust plans to minimize disruptions and maintain output targets.
  • Coordinate closely with production, materials, and logistics teams to ensure the availability of raw materials, components, and finished goods.
  • Manage capacity planning and identify constraints that may affect production flow, recommending mitigation actions.
  • Download, analyze, and consolidate customer demand data to identify trends, variances, and potential risks.
  • Develop and maintain supply strategies, including defining order quantities, safety stock levels, and lead times.
  • Balance demand requirements with production capabilities and inventory constraints to maintain service levels.
  • Support material shortage tracking and coordinate resolution efforts with internal stakeholders and external partners.
  • Develop and implement overseas shipping plans that align with customer demand and production schedules.
  • Analyze inventory levels, demand forecasts, and shipment timelines to optimize global distribution and minimize stockouts or excess inventory.
  • Collaborate with logistics, procurement, sales, and program management teams to align shipping and planning strategies.
  • Maintain proactive communication with carriers and freight partners to manage shipment execution, changes, and potential delays.
  • Analyze supply chain, production, and inventory data to identify trends, risks, and opportunities for improvement.
  • Own and maintain planning dashboards, including waterfall reports and shipment tracking tools, ensuring data accuracy and visibility.
  • Provide regular reporting and insights to management on supply risks, performance metrics, and forecast accuracy.
  • Utilize SAP and other planning or ERP systems to support accurate data management and informed decision-making.
  • Identify opportunities to improve planning processes, reduce lead times, and increase overall supply chain efficiency.
  • Evaluate supplier performance and support corrective actions when needed to improve reliability and service levels.
  • Support cross-functional initiatives that enhance communication and alignment across departments involved in the supply chain.
  • Work closely with logistics coordinators to support warehouse operations, including shipping, receiving, and maintaining inventory accuracy.
